Rudolfplatz, a bustling square in the heart of Cologne, serves as a vibrant meeting point for locals and tourists alike. Steeped in history, the square is home to the Hahnentorburg, one of the few remaining medieval city gates, dating back to the 13th century. More than just a historical landmark, Rudolfplatz is a transportation hub and a lively space for markets, events, and everyday city life. Surrounded by shops, cafes, and the trendy Belgian Quarter, it offers a blend of culture, history, and urban energy. Whether you're exploring Cologne's past, enjoying a coffee, or attending a local event, Rudolfplatz provides a central and engaging experience. The square is easily accessible by public transport and offers a variety of activities throughout the year, making it a must-see destination for any visitor to Cologne. Its central location also makes it a perfect starting point for exploring other Cologne highlights, such as the Cologne Cathedral and the Belgian Quarter.

Getting There
-
Public Transport
Rudolfplatz is a major public transport hub. From Cologne Central Station (Hauptbahnhof), take subway lines 16 or 18 towards Bonn to Neumarkt station (€1-3). Then, transfer to line 1 towards Weiden or line 7 towards Frechen and get off at Rudolfplatz station. Alternatively, from Neumarkt, take bus lines 136 or 146 directly to Rudolfplatz (€1-3). The journey takes approximately 15-20 minutes.
-
Walking
From Neumarkt, a central shopping area, Rudolfplatz is approximately a 10-15 minute walk. Head west along Mittelstraße, a high-end shopping street, until you reach Rudolfplatz. You'll see the Hahnentorburg (medieval city gate) directly in front of you as you approach the square. The walk is straightforward and offers a pleasant glimpse of Cologne's city center.
-
Taxi/Ride-Share
A taxi or ride-share from Cologne Central Station (Hauptbahnhof) to Rudolfplatz typically costs between €7-€10 and takes approximately 5-10 minutes, depending on traffic. From Neumarkt, a taxi/ride-share will cost around €5-€8.
-
Driving
If driving, navigate to Habsburgerring 9, 50674 Köln, where you'll find the 'Tiefgarage Rudolfplatz' parking garage. Parking costs approximately €3 per hour, with a maximum daily rate of €30. Be aware that parking in the city center can be limited, especially during peak hours and events.
